NEW DELHI: A 25-year-old man, already facing six cases related to "culpable homicide," allegedly shot his mother in Delhi’s Dhul Siras village, according to police officials on Sunday.
The Delhi Police were alerted when a hospital reported admitting the 52-year-old woman with a gunshot injury, according to news agency ANI.
Initially, when officers arrived at the hospital, the victim and her husband attempted to deceive authorities by saying that, "she was shot by an unknown person."
After further questioning of family members, her 25-year-old son Abhishek "confessed to having shot her."
"Six cases of culpable homicide and outraging modesty of women are already registered against the accused," the police said.
Further investigation is still underway, police said. More details awaited.
